Amos remains a bass gear junkie, constantly searching for new tones and sonic toys. He takes a straight-ahead approach to his tone, relying on great basses as opposed to lots of outboard gear. A proud Fender endorsee, Amos used his ’62 RI Precision (loaded with Seymour Duncan Quarter Pounders) on almost everything during the last U.S. tour, though he also carried a Cabronita P-bass and a Dimension 5 for extended range. His one “quirky” bass, a ’71 Orlando, also sees some use. His pedalboard is modest: an Xotic Bass RC Booster, a Radial Classic Tube Distortion, and an ancient Ibanez chorus, all controlled by tech Steve Uncapher. With no amps on stage, Amos runs it all through an Avalon U5 preamp.

Featured on Heller's official Nordstrand Audio artist page.

Amos is using the Nordstrand Big Splits and nj5s Set.

“I’ve been very impressed with the focused and precise sound of Nordstrand pickups. They give me a full sound that communicates the character of the bass with clarity.”

As Swift’s bass guitarist for eight years, Heller uses several guitars on stage. He added the Roscoe Century Standard Plus 5J, a five-string bass, in June to play “Love Story” and “Style.”

Heller needs a guitar that he can start playing quickly on stage, without a lot of adjustments. His Roscoe bass does that, he said.

When he first tried it, “It knocked me out right away,” Heller said from his Nashville home.

He compliments the guitar with the flame maple top, body of alder wood, satin tobacco sunburst finish and maple fingerboard.

“The thing I like so much about the Roscoe,” Heller said, “is this excellent marriage of these beautiful aesthetic appointments and this overall attention to detail, but it balances very well when you strap it on; it’s extremely comfortable to play. It’s got a very versatile palette of tones at your disposal, but they are very easy to get to.”

He liked it so much that Roscoe made him another, a customized Century Signature 4 with a buckeye burl top, alder body and Bolivian rosewood fingerboard.

Heller said he plans to pick it up before Wednesday’s concert and play it that night.
